current thoughts on mechanics of posting sensitive content here; anything wrong?

toot unlisted: visible if rando views yr timeline; goes to all followers; seems? to be excluded from tag search, even if you tag it (though why would you)

toot private: only visible to followers ON YOUR INSTANCE; those off-instance cannot see, i'm told

toot direct: must list all recipients, so only feasible if you're only including a few people

general privacy: once a toot is federated it is on the remote instances forever; you lack ability to delete everywhere but yr local instance. therefore use an external hosting site for sensitive images so you can delete them at will.

@alyx you can delete everywhere but it's sort of a "honor pact" thing, instances *should delete it* but and there's no known instances that *don't* but they could fail to delete it because of a bug.
